HP and T-Mobile release SuperPhone!

iPAQ has always been the best of the Pocket PC's - but it has historically been a real pain to make them wireless.  Now the new HP 6315 is the answer, with T-mobile service built in!  With its QUAD band GSM/GPRS, you can NEVER be in the "Wrong Area", this little guy will work anywhere on Earth that has GSM/GPRS.  It has a removable keypad to make it easy to manage those keyed credit card entries, and it works perfectly with our Pocket Verifier Professional,

This new, breakthrough device works perfectly with our newest card reader and printer, called the Pocket Spectrum, and has a number of improvements over the Pocket Merchant, our cabled reader / printer device. Click here to see how to set this up.

  A true Line Printer (the paper moves underneath a motionless head) , rated not in characters, but MILES of paper in reliability (31 to be precise)! Powered by powerful, built-in Nickel - Metal Hydride rechargeable batteries, this printer literally throws receipts out at up to 2 inches per second!  Pocket Spectrum has a larger paper roll then Pocket Merchant, a full 34 feet for 136 receipts per roll!

  Pocket Spectrum uses a removable battery pack, and includes a separate charger station.

  FREE Stuff! Everybody loves free stuff, and you can get all sorts of Visa, Mastercard, American Express and Discover merchant materials just by asking!  Actually, you need to go to the proper places on their websites and tell them what you want! The links to these sites are at the bottom of this newsletter, and you can get decals, tip trays, calendars, signs, mouse pads and more!  You 'pay' for it simply by identifying yourself as a merchant with your merchant number.   Look on your statements for this number
